The High Court of Punjab and Haryana set aside the trial court's order declaring Faljit Singh a proclaimed person in a cheque bouncing case (Sections 138/142, Negotiable Instruments Act) under the condition that he pay Rs. 20,000 to the complainant and appear before the trial court within 10 days. The court found the proclamation order appropriate to cancel without examining the merits of his absence claims, granting him arrest protection during the compliance period.
